About CS Academy
CS Academy, Coimbatore has three campuses. Two are in Kovaipudur (Main) in adjacent facilities and the third primary campus is in the heart of the city at Red Fields. Our boarding house in Kovaipudur is open for boys and girls from class IV for both CBSE and Cambridge International students. The picturesque main campus located in the foothills of the Western Ghats is ideally suited for exploring and learning
Our team brings a wealth of expertise in education. Our CBSE and Cambridge programmes and teaching methodology are proven and time tested. We have built on vast experience and developed a programme that encompasses modern tools while adhering to traditional principles.
Our mission is to equip our students with the knowledge and skills required to succeed in the real world by providing practical and holistic education in a challenging, yet nurturing environment. We prepare students for success by focusing on four pillars: Academic excellence, Skill building, Core Values and Healthy competition.
In 2024, CS Academy Coimbatore joined the prestigious International Schools Partnership (ISP) group. With over 111 schools in 25 countries, ISP is a leading global network of educational institutions. As a member of this esteemed network, CS Academy Coimbatore enjoys unparalleled international learning connections, unwavering quality assurance, and exceptional governance.

CSA - Primary ICT Teacher
Key Responsibilities:
Teaching & Learning
- Plan and deliver ICT lessons for Primary grades aligned with curriculum guidelines
- Teach basic computer skills, digital tools, and age-appropriate coding concepts
- Introduce students to applications such as word processing, presentations, spreadsheets, and educational software
- Promote safe, ethical, and responsible use of technology
Curriculum & Assessment
- Prepare lesson plans, worksheets, and digital resources
- Assess and record student progress using appropriate assessment methods
- Support integration of ICT into other subjects (cross-curricular learning)
Classroom & Lab Management
- Maintain discipline and ensure student safety in the computer lab
- Ensure proper use and care of ICT equipment
- Report technical issues and coordinate with IT support when required
Student Engagement & Development
- Encourage creativity, collaboration, and problem-solving through technology
- Support students with varying learning abilities
- Motivate students to participate in ICT-based activities and projects
Professional Responsibilities
- Participate in staff meetings, training sessions, and school events
- Stay updated with emerging educational technologies and teaching practices
- Follow school policies, child safeguarding, and data protection guidelines
